About

Dr. P. Chomtong is a rising researcher in optical wireless communications (OWC), with a focus on enabling high-speed data transmission in challenging, confined environments. Their most-cited work, "Advanced Studies on Optical Wireless Communications for in-Pipe Environments" (2024), pioneers a Gbps-capable OWC system using a 1W LED across five wavelengths within plastic pipes. This study systematically explores signal power, attenuation, and bandwidth, offering a practical alternative for in-pipe data links where traditional radio frequency methods fail.
